Anhydrous Sodium Acetate (CH₃COONa) is a white, odorless, and hygroscopic crystalline compound with a strong buffering ability. As an essential reagent in both industrial and laboratory settings, it plays a key role in a variety of applications such as chemical synthesis, food processing, and as a buffering agent in pharmaceuticals. Its anhydrous nature makes it ideal for use in processes that require precise control over moisture levels.

Anhydrous Sodium Acetate is produced through the reaction of acetic acid with sodium carbonate or sodium hydroxide. The resulting sodium acetate is carefully dried at controlled temperatures to remove all water content, ensuring the product remains in its anhydrous form.
Sodium Acetate, as a buffering agent, maintains the pH of solutions by resisting changes in pH levels when acids or bases are added. Its anhydrous form is particularly valuable for maintaining the integrity of formulations where moisture can cause degradation or unwanted reactions.
